Página 1 de 1

combobox con tabla mariadb

Publicado: Mar Nov 21, 2017 2:56 am
por magjem
saludos !


METHOD Combobox2Create( oSender ) CLASS TForm2
with object ::oBids
aitems := :Queryarray("SELECT Projectname from oBids Order by Projectname" )
...


--------------------- Internal Error Handling Information ---------------------

Subsystem Call: BASE
System Code: 1004
Default Status: .F.
Description: Message or field name not found
Operation: TSQLQuery:QUERYARRAY
Arguments: [ 1] = Type: C Val: SELECT Projectname from oBids Order by Projectname
Involved File:
Dos Error Code: 0


La tabla de mdb es oBids
el campo deseado es Projectname

deseo cargar el combobox con los valores del campo Projectname de la tabla oBIDS
no encuentro lo que hago mal

Ayuda porfa
Gracias

Re: combobox con tabla mariadb

Publicado: Mar Nov 21, 2017 1:10 pm
por ftwein
Hola.

QueryArray es un método de la clase T???DataSource, como TADODataSource.

TSQLQuery no tiene este método.

Fausto Di Creddo Trautwein

Re: combobox con tabla mariadb

Publicado: Mar Nov 21, 2017 7:11 pm
por magjem
con esto resolvi el dilema, por si le ayuda a alguien mas
gracias

METHOD FormInitialize( oSender ) CLASS TForm2
::oBids:GoTop()
DO WHILE !::oBids:Eof()
::oComboBox4:AddItem( ::obids:Projectname )
::oBids:Skip()
ENDDO
return nil